Ateneo de Naga University

Ateneo de Naga University (ADNU) is located in Naga City, Bicol, Philippines. The university was established in 1940. It is accredited by Commission on Higher Education, Philippines.

University Profile

Get a quick snapshot of the university's key details.

University Name Ateneo de Naga University
Acronym ADNU
Year Established 1940
Motto Primum Regnum Dei
Motto in English First, the Kingdom of God
Colors Blue and gold
